Full-Frame Sensor, BIONZ X Processor, and Stabilization
Incorporated into the a7 II's redesigned body is a full-frame 24.3MP Exmor CMOS sensor, which offers a wide dynamic range with minimal noise and rich, subtle gradations. The sensor also offers an ISO range of 100-51,200 which can be expanded down to ISO 50. Coupled with the BIONZ X processor, this camera also supports fluid performance for high-speed shooting applications, including the ability to shoot continuously at up to 5 fps and record Full HD video at up to 60p

5-Axis SteadyShot INSIDE Image Stabilization
Packed into the svelte a7 II is a 5-axis SteadyShot INSIDE image stabilization system, which compensates for five types of camera shake encountered during handheld shooting of still images and video. This allows users to confidently use any lens, even adapted lenses, for critical imaging without encountering blur from camera shake. This system will compensate for approximately 4.5 stops of shutter speed for working with a huge variety of subjects.

Enhanced Fast Hybrid AF
Utilizing 117 phase-detection and 25 contrast-detection autofocus points with a wide area of coverage, the a7 II can smoothly and quickly track fast-moving subjects throughout the frame. It optimizes for both speed and accuracy with an enhanced algorithm that improves performance by about 30% when compared to previous generations. This just-developed algorithm will more accurately predict subject movement for tracking that is 1.5x more accurate. Also, Lock-on AF tracking will analyze more information from the scene to provide dramatically improved accuracy and stability and Eye AF can prioritize a subject's pupil for excellent portraits even with a shallow depth of field.

Video Recording
Full HD and XAVC S Format
Shoot Full HD 1920 x 1080 video at frame rates of 60p, 30p, and 24p with the high-bit-rate 50 Mbps XAVC S format. This results in excellent image quality with minimal noise and artifacts without requiring a large amount of disk space. Additionally, the system uses linear PCM sound for high quality audio.

When recording internally, users will record video with a 4:2:0 sampling at 8-bit, however, to even further improve image quality the a7 II has clean HDMI output for use with an external recorder. This allows users to capture 4:2:2 uncompressed video and save in an edit-ready format.

Customizable Color Profiles and S-Log2 Gamma
To make sure the a7 II is able to use its extensive dynamic range while recording video it incorporates extensive customizable color and gamma controls. Users can adjust the gamma, black level, knee, color level, and more. Also users can use the same S-Log2 Gamma Curve that is found on high end Sony Cinema cameras that squeezes up to 1300% more dynamic range into the video signal then traditional REC709, for increased post-production flexibility.

Audio Input & Headphone Jack
The a7 II features a 3.5mm microphone input jack for compatibility with external microphones. And for users needing more the a7 II is also compatible with the Sony XLR-K2M XLR Adapter for recording professional balanced XLR audio signals with phantom power and adjustable mic/line inputs. For monitoring audio the a7 II features a 3.5mm headphone jack as well as real time audio levels for a visual reference.

Body Design
Refined EVF, LCD, and Ergonomics
  • High-resolution 2.36m-dot OLED viewfinder offers a bright, clear means for eye-level viewing.
  • Rear LCD now features a higher 1.2m-dot resolution along with a versatile tilting design that moves upward 107° and downward 41° for working from high and low angles.
  • Featuring a larger, more refined grip shape, users will find the a7 II to have a more secure feel even when large lenses are mounted.
  • Shutter release button has been reshaped and moved forward for a more natural shooting position and a decrease in camera shake.
  • Button customization is available with the ability to assign any of 56 functions to any of the 10 customizable buttons for a more personalized setup.
Magnesium Alloy Construction and Robust Lens Mount
  • Well-built design includes a magnesium alloy top cover, front cover, and internal structure and the lens mount has been redesigned with greater strength and rigidity for extra security when using larger or longer lenses.
  • Improved weather sealing for greater dust and moisture resistance, providing more protection when shooting out in the elements.
  • Optical filter on the sensor has an anti-static coating and there is an anti-dust mechanism to prevent dust from adhering to the sensor.
Connectivity
Wi-Fi and NFC
Built-in Wi-Fi connectivity enables the a7 II to instantly share imagery to mobile devices for direct sharing online to social networking, via email, and to cloud storage sites. NFC (Near Field Communication) is also supported, which allows for one-touch connection between the camera and compatible mobile devices; no complex set-up is required. Once connected, the linked mobile device can also display a live view image on its screen and remotely control the camera's shutter.
Sony FE 28-70mm f/3.5-5.6 OSS Lens
A Versatile Standard
A top pick for users looking for a lightweight all-around zoom, the FE 28-70mm f/3.5-5.6 OSS Lens from Sony is a great go-to for full-frame E-mount shooters. The lens has a compact, portable design that is ideal for everyday, walkaround use and its versatile wide-angle to portrait-length range suits working with a variety of subject types.
Optical Design
  • One extra-low dispersion glass element is featured in the lens design to help reduce chromatic aberrations and color fringing for improved clarity and color neutrality.
  • Three aspherical elements are incorporated in the lens design to reduce astigmatism, field curvature, coma, and other monochromatic aberrations.
  • Rounded seven-blade diaphragm contributes to a pleasing bokeh quality when employing selective focus techniques.
Autofocus, Image Stabilization, and Design
  • An internal focus mechanism and linear motor contribute to faster, more responsive system and easier handling.
  • Optical SteadyShot image stabilization helps to minimize the appearance of camera shake for sharper imagery when shooting handheld with slower shutter speeds. This stabilization system can be combined with select camera's sensor-shift type image stabilization for more effective control of camera blur.
  • Dust- and moisture-sealed design better permits working in inclement conditions and rubberized control rings benefit handling in colder temperatures.
